Wired has released a roundup of the five best outdoor griddles and flat-top grills for 2026 [1].
This guide arrives as homeowners seek more versatile cooking options for the summer season. Flat-top grills allow for a wider variety of breakfast and dinner items compared to traditional grate grills, making them a staple for backyard entertaining.
The selection process focused on performance and suitability for outdoor settings [1]. While the full list highlights five top performers, the market remains competitive with frequent pricing shifts for popular models.
For example, a Charbroil three-burner gas griddle saw a significant price drop earlier this month. The unit, which typically costs $400 [2], was listed at a sale price of $199 [2] at Walmart in April 2026.
Consumer interest in these appliances often peaks during the spring and summer months. The 2026 guide aims to help buyers navigate the differences between gas and electric models to find the most efficient setup for their specific space [1].
